Summary

Republican lawmakers in Michigan are proposing a bill to change the state's apprenticeship ratio, allowing skilled workers to supervise two construction apprentices instead of the current one-to-one ratio. This legislative move aims to address the pressing need for skilled construction workers, as the industry faces a significant shortage due to retirements and increasing demand.

The push for this change comes amid record enrollment in registered apprenticeship programs, with over 17,000 apprentices in the state. The current apprenticeship model, which has been in place since 2017, is seen as a barrier for small businesses and the construction industry, which relies heavily on these programs for workforce development.

Why this matters for apprenticeships

This proposed change is significant as it could enhance the capacity of apprenticeship programs, especially for small businesses struggling to attract and train new talent. By increasing the ratio of apprentices to journeyworkers, the legislation aims to streamline the training process, thus helping to meet the growing demand for skilled labor in the construction sector.
